Court ordered the husband to divorce his wife
The Family Court ordered a Kuwaiti citizen to divorce his wife due to the harms he caused her, and give her entire rights following the divorce. Lawyer Zaid Al-Khabbaz had filed the lawsuit on the behalf of the wife, after her husband kicked her out along with her daughter.
Fake Accidents in Kuwait, take care
Jleeb Al-Shuyoukh securitymen have arrested a gang led by a Pakistani expatriate that was responsible for fabricating a number of traffic accidents in which they were victims, reports Al-Anba daily.

Arrested two Asians
A person trying to avoid checking led security operatives to a liquor factory inside a flat in Mahboula area, and two Asian residency violators were arrested.

Taxi Driver Arrested
An Egyptian taxi driver was arrested in possession of drugs and drug paraphernalia in Khaitan area, reports Al-Rai daily.
Indian gang was making 70000 KD per month, arrested
Personnel from the Criminal Investigations Department headed by Acting Director-General Major General Mohammad Al-Sharhan have arrested a gang of Indians for trespassing into the basic broadcasting offices of a company and gave channels connection to a number of buildings in Salmiya illegally and earning KD 70,000 monthly.
